Why Host This Show?
Our performance is founded on four distinct pillars detailed below. The ultimate point, however, is that we engage the most number of people with the least hassle for the greatest value to them and to you.
High Audience Retention
Unlike generic background music, this is a conversational, audience-steered storytelling and musical perfor mance. By shifting the presentation dynamically based on crowd interest, we maintain high engagement over multiple hours, keeping patrons in seats and driving ongoing food and beverage sales.
Zero Technical Friction
Our current format is completely self-contained, requiring zero complex audio/visual setups, long soundchecks, or venue intervention. Armed with historical props, traditional instruments, and custom-designed manuscript mapping, the performance sets up in 10 minutes and fits seamlessly into any intimate or high-density environment.
Built in Visual Draw
The "Scriptorium" stage aesthetic—featuring antiquarian tools, historical instruments, and tactile dark-fantasy design — provides a striking physical anchor that captures foot traffic the moment patrons walk through the door.
Bespoke Merchandising Continuity
The performance acts as a direct funnel to a premium retail table. Patrons don't just leave with a memory—they clear inventory, purchasing high-value Celtic playing cards, worldbuilding manuscripts, and digital companion tokens directly from the display, adding an secondary visual asset to the venue’s evening market space.
